Touring cycling around Kynsivesi, located in Central Finland, offers diverse terrain characterized by a medium-sized lake with numerous islands. The region features varied landscapes, from mostly paved surfaces to unpaved segments, with significant elevation differences in areas adjacent to the Southern Konnevesi National Park. Clear waters and rugged mountains contribute to the natural appeal, providing a scenic backdrop for cycling routes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many touring cycling routes are available around Kynsivesi?

There are 6 touring cycling routes around Kynsivesi, offering a variety of experiences for different skill levels. These include 2 easy routes, 3 moderate routes, and 1 difficult route.

What kind of terrain can I expect on Kynsivesi cycling routes?

The Kynsivesi region offers diverse terrain. You can expect a mix of mostly paved surfaces and unpaved segments. Some routes, particularly those closer to the Southern Konnevesi National Park, feature significant elevation differences and rugged landscapes. The area is characterized by numerous islands, clear waters, and picturesque natural features.

Are there any circular touring cycling routes in Kynsivesi?

Yes, all the touring cycling routes listed for Kynsivesi are circular loops, allowing you to start and end your ride at the same point. For example, you could try the Forest Road in Finland loop from Niemisjärvi for an easy ride.

What natural features or landmarks can I see while cycling around Kynsivesi?

While cycling around Kynsivesi, you'll encounter beautiful natural features. The region is known for its clear waters and numerous islands, such as Paanalansaari. You can also experience the Simunankoski rapids, which are part of the Kymijoki main catchment area. The Siikakoski Rapids in Konnevesi – Information Board and Map loop from Liesvesi specifically passes by the scenic Siikakoski Rapids.

Are there family-friendly touring cycling routes in Kynsivesi?

Yes, Kynsivesi offers family-friendly options. There are 2 easy routes that are suitable for a more relaxed pace. The Forest Road in Finland loop from Niemisjärvi is an easy 19.0 km route that provides a gentle introduction to touring cycling in the area.

Is there parking available near the touring cycling routes?

While specific parking locations are not detailed for every route, many touring cycling routes in Kynsivesi start from towns or villages like Niemisjärvi, Liesvesi, Lievestuore, and Hankasalmi. It is generally advisable to look for public parking facilities within these starting points.

How can I reach the Kynsivesi cycling routes by public transport?

The Kynsivesi region is located in Central Finland, with routes starting from various municipalities such as Laukaa, Hankasalmi, and Konnevesi. While direct public transport links to every trailhead might be limited, you can typically reach the larger towns like Hankasalmi or Lievestuore by regional bus services. From there, you may need to cycle to the specific route starting points.

Are there places to eat or stay near the cycling routes in Kynsivesi?

Yes, the towns and villages around Kynsivesi, such as Hankasalmi, Lievestuore, and Liesvesi, offer services for cyclists. You can find cafes and potentially accommodation options in these areas. For example, the Melli-Elli Café loop from Hankasalmi suggests a route that includes a cafe.

What do other touring cyclists say about the routes in Kynsivesi?

The touring cycling routes in Kynsivesi are highly regarded by the komoot community, with an average score of 5.0 stars from 2 reviews. Over 40 touring cyclists have used komoot to explore the varied terrain, often praising the scenic beauty and diverse landscapes of the region.

Are there routes with significant elevation gain for a challenge?

Yes, if you're looking for a challenge, there is one difficult route available. The Purtolampi – Häähninmäki loop from Hankasalmi is a 22.3 km trail with 208 meters of elevation gain, offering a more demanding ride through varied terrain.

What is the best time of year for touring cycling in Kynsivesi?

The best time for touring cycling in Kynsivesi is typically during the warmer months, from late spring to early autumn (May to September). During this period, the weather is generally pleasant, and the natural beauty of the lakes, islands, and forests is at its peak. Always check local weather forecasts before heading out.
